Compound bow draw length adjustment.

Adjusting The Single Cam Draw Length Using draw length modules, the draw length can be adjusted in 1" increments. To change the draw length, replace the module on the cam by removing the screws that hold it to the cam. NOTE: do not draw your bow without the module installed. It will damage your . harness. Like.If you want to increase your draw length, you’ll need to loosen the limb bolts slightly and twist the limbs outwards. For a decrease in draw length, do the opposite – tighten the limb bolts and twist the limbs inwards. Each click of a limb bolt should change the draw length by about ⅛ of an inch.A compound bow's cam system can be used as a second means of adjusting the draw length. The compound bow's distinctive shooting characteristics are due to the cam mechanism. The bow's draw length can be altered by shifting the cam's position. You would advance the cam on the axle of the bow to prolong the draw length.

Every cam system allows the draw length adjustment with the use of an Allen wrench. The newer ...To measure the draw length of your bow, you want to start at full draw. Then, go from the grip's pivot in a perpendicular direction to the string's nocking point. Add 1.75 inches to your total and you should have your draw length. Once you know your draw length, you can find it’s corresponding number on the bear compound bow …Compound bows are a little different from traditional recurves and longbows. Unlike traditional bows which can be drawn back practically any distance, compound bows are engineered to draw back only so far - and then stop. This distance is known as the bow's "draw length" - and it's controlled by the mechanical systems on the bow.To increase the draw weight of your compound bow, you will need to turn the limb bolts clockwise. This rotation increases the tension in the limbs, making it more difficult to pull back the bowstring to full draw length. Applying equal turns to both limbs. Method 1: The “Arms Out” Method (Arm Span 2.5) Method 2: Testing with Actual Drawing (The Archers Method) Method 3: Wing Span Method (Wall Measurement Technique) Method 4: Cross-Verify ⁤Using ⁢The “Fist ⁢to Mouth” Method.3/16-inch Allen key. Locate the bow limb bolts. These are located at both bow ends, just above the cams, and are recognizable by their 3/16-inch Allen key screw-heads. Use the Allen key to turn each bolt counter-clockwise to decrease the draw weight. Specifications. Axle-to-axle 32" brace ... inmate search el paso county coloradopimp snooky The cam-1/2 system has a draw length module. with holes labelled "A" through "F". Moving the screw from one hole to the next hole will change the draw length. by 1/2-inch. When you change the draw length, you will need to adjust the cam rotation.
